在Vue 中使用 scrollTo 或scrollTop 时,如果遇到失效的问题,通常可以从以下几个方面进行排查和解决: 确认作用元素: 确保scrollTo 或scrollTop 是作用在一个具有滚动条的可滚动元素上。如果作用在不可滚动的元素上,这些属性将不会生效。 例如,如果一个 div 没有设置固定高度并且其内容没有超出容器的显示范围,那...
.vue mounted(){ this.scrollToBottom() }, methods:{ scrollToBottom: function () { this.$nextTick(() => { var container = this.$el.querySelector('.chatContent'); container.scrollTop = container.scrollHeight; }) } }, updated:function () { this.scrollToBottom(); } 就想让div滚动条...
mounted(){ this.scrollToBottom() }, methods:{ scrollToBottom: function () { this.$nextTick(() => { var container = this.$el.querySelector('.chatContent'); container.scrollTop = container.scrollHeight; }) } }, updated:function () { this.scrollToBottom(); } 就想让div滚动条始终...
mounted(){ this.scrollToBottom() }, methods:{ scrollToBottom: function () { this.$nextTick(() => { var container = this.$el.querySelector('.chatContent'); container.scrollTop = container.scrollHeight; }) } }, updated:function () { this.scrollToBottom(); } 就想让div滚动条始终...
你不要直接这样给scrollTop赋值,用方法去滚动window.scrollTo(x坐标,Y坐标)window.scrollTo(0, div.scrollHeight)应该是像楼下说的,你的图片没加载完就计算高度了,高度计算不正确导致的。你给图片加个onload事件,加载完后再重新调用一下那个移动到底部的方法。 0 0 0 没找到需要的内容?换个关键词再搜...
新人求助,windo..因为刚工作,第一次接触vue。公司这边一个需求,需要点击浮动菜单,可以直接下滑到指定的div,我自己找了几个例子,试了下,发现如果是一个单页,可以实现,但是放到elementui那个布局容器里面就无效
点击索引表,实现滚动到相应的模块就非常简单了。根据当前点击索引的索引,找到this.indexTopOffset里面的scrollTop值,然后利用iscroll里面的scrollTo方法滚动就可以了。Vue中实现table的首行首列固定1、首先,打开html编辑器,新建html文件,例如:index.html。在index.html中的table标签中的第一个td标签,...
</div> </template> <script>import Vuefrom"vue"; import VueScrollTofrom"vue-scrollto"; Vue.use(VueScrollTo, options);//https://github.com/rigor789/vue-scrolltolet options={ container:"body",//滚动的容器duration:500,//滚动时间easing:"ease",//缓动类型offset:0,//滚动时应应用的偏移量。
<script>exportdefault{name:"totop",data() {return{btnFlag:false, }; },// 利用VUE写一个在控制台打印当前的scrollTop。首先,在 mounted 钩子中给window添加一个滚动滚动监听事件mounted() {window.addEventListener("scroll",this.scrollToTop,true);//如果你需要把这个页面当做子组件引入 需要加true 因为...
你不要直接这样给scrollTop赋值,用方法去滚动window.scrollTo(x坐标,Y坐标) window.scrollTo(0, div.scrollHeight) 应该是像楼下说的,你的图片没加载完就计算高度了,高度计算不正确导致的。你给图片加个onload事件,加载完后再重新调用一下那个移动到底部的方法。 有用2 回复 cccrrr: 还是不可以,我在对话框...